METHOD FOR THE AUTOMATIC ADAPTATION OF A LIGHT BEAM OF A HEADLIGHT DEVICE
First Claim
1. A method for the automatic adaptation of a light beam of a headlight device of a first motor vehicle traveling on a road, the headlight device being able to perform a lighting function of the dipped beam type producing a light beam of the dipped type, and a lighting function of the motorway type producing a light beam of the motorway type, the lighting function of the dipped beam type being activated, wherein it comprises the steps of:
- detecting the presence of at least a second vehicle, being followed or passed in the opposite direction, not to be dazzled;
estimating an instantaneous distance separating the first vehicle from the second vehicle; and
determining whether the estimated instantaneous distance is greater than a first threshold value, referred to as the threshold value for activating the motorway lighting function;
where necessary, activating the motorway lighting function.

Abstract
A proposed method to illuminate optimally, or at least in an improved fashion compared with existing solutions, a road taken by a vehicle in question implementing the method whilst ensuring that other vehicles are not dazzled. To this end, it is not proposed in the invention to detect the distance between the vehicle in question and the first vehicle liable to be dazzled by the vehicle in question, and to generate accordingly a light beam optimized in terms of range on the road, and advantageously light intensity; according to the invention, the optimization of the light beam produced is achieved by the use of the motorway function available on the vehicle in question. The use of this function in this context also ensures a gradual transition between the function of the dipped type and the function of the main-beam type in the context of automatic switching operations between these functions.
